Operating Restrictions:
The Premises shall be regularly kept open and operated in a bona fide manner while making a real offer or holding out to sell and serve meals to guests for compensation.
The quarterly gross sales of alcoholic beverages shall not exceed the quarterly gross sales of food during the same period. The licensee shall at all times maintain records which reflect separately the gross sale of food and the gross sales of alcoholic beverages of the licensed business. Said records shall be kept no less frequently than on a quarterly basis and shall be made available to the Department on demand.
The licensee shall comply with the provisions of Section 23038 of the Business and Professions Code and acknowledges that incidental, sporadic or infrequent sales of meals or a mere offering of meals without actual sales shall not be deemed sufficient to consider the premises in compliance with the aforementioned code section.
The premises shall be equipped and maintained in good faith and shall possess, in operative condition, such conveniences for cooking and storage of foods such as stoves, ovens, broilers, refrigeration or other devices, as well as pots, pans or containers which can be used for cooking or heating foods on the type heating device employed.
During normal meal hours, at least the premises seating shall be designed and used for and must possess the necessary utensils, table service, and condiment dispensers with which to serve meals to the public.
The premises shall be maintained as a bona fide food restaurant and shall provide a menu containing an assortment of foods normally offered in such restaurants.
The petitioner(s) shall stock and offer for sale a substantial assortment of food and/or merchandise commonly associated with and sold to persons in the community of extraction.
During normal meal hours, the licensee(s) shall employ and use the services of adequate staff and employ for the preparation and service of meals, such as cook(s) and waitress(es).
Food Facilities must be maintained in a sanitary condition to comply with all the regulations of the local health department.
At all times during normal meal hours, during which the licensee(s) is/are exercising the privileges of the applied for license, said licensee(s) shall offer meals consistent with what is customarily offered during said meal period. Normal meal hours are considered to at least, but not limited to: Breakfast-6:00am to 9:00am; Lunch-11:00am to 2:00pm; Dinner-6:00pm-9:00pm
The sale of alcoholic beverages for consumption off the premises is strictly prohibited.
At all times when the premises are open for business the sale of alcoholic beverages shall be made only in conjunction with the sale of food.
